Transaction d7836cce6268a17649d8942d1f4733d0056389dc501e5ec88b27787b22864a7d
1 Input
1 Output
-
d7836cce6268a17649d8942d1f4733d0056389dc501e5ec88b27787b22864a7d:0
- value
- 21327
- script pubkey
- OP_0 OP_PUSHBYTES_20 3df9f71971a2df0535db43b24633e34d0259246d
- address
- bc1q8hulwxt35t0s2dwmgweyvvlrf5p9jfrdc0m4qa